How does Dog Haus protect the confidentiality of the Confidential Information?
Dog_Haus Franchise · 2025 FDDAnswer from 2025 FDD Document
Franchisor has and continues to protect the confidentiality of the Confidential Information by, among other things, (i) not revealing the confidential contents of the Confidential Information to unauthorized parties; (ii) requiring Dog Haus franchisees to acknowledge and agree in writing that the Confidential Information is confidential; (iii) requiring Dog Haus franchisees to agree in writing to maintain the confidentiality of the Confidential Information; (iv) monitoring electronic access to the Confidential Information by the use of passwords and other restrictions so that electronic access to the Confidential Information is limited to authorized parties; and (v) requiring its franchisees to return all Confidential Information to Franchisor upon the expiration and termination of their Franchise Agreements.

What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Dog Haus's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, Dog Haus takes several measures to protect the confidentiality of its confidential information. These measures are designed to ensure that sensitive business information remains secure and is not disclosed to unauthorized parties. These efforts to maintain secrecy are a crucial aspect of protecting the brand's competitive advantage and operational integrity.
Dog Haus ensures franchisees acknowledge and agree in writing that the confidential information is confidential. Franchisees must also agree in writing to maintain the confidentiality of this information. Furthermore, Dog Haus monitors electronic access to the confidential information through passwords and other restrictions, limiting access to authorized parties only. This multi-layered approach helps to control and track who can access sensitive data, reducing the risk of unauthorized disclosure.
Additionally, Dog Haus requires its franchisees to return all confidential information upon the expiration or termination of their Franchise Agreements. This step is essential to prevent former franchisees from using proprietary information to compete with the brand or share it with others. Dog Haus also mandates that franchisees obtain written agreements from all supervisorial or managerial personnel and independent contractors who may have access to confidential information, ensuring they maintain confidentiality both during and after their association with the franchisee. This extends the circle of protection to include anyone working within the franchise who might come into contact with sensitive data.
